I wanted to share a new song. It’s a work in progress. It started with a groove and a first verse. I think it might need a fourth verse but it is getting close.


There’s a knot in the middle of my stomach
Squeezing me from the inside
Might be hungry but when I try to eat
Can’t get anything down
It’s an empty pit, deep down deep
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ill my soul

Pour one out for a guy I used to know
He’s been gone a long time
I think that maybe that guy is me
But I can’t remember his face
He looks more like a silhouette
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ill my soul 

I’ve been walking all day long
But I never left this room
A cold sweat and worn out shoes 
My toes are leaking through 
I cut my laces and wipe my brow 
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ill it
Never gonna fill my soul
